Twins: Chapters 3–11

Twin sisters Maureen and Francine have always done everything together — but when the girls start sixth grade, they face challenges and conflicts in their relationship.

Full list of words from this list:

  1. interchangeable
    such that the arguments or roles can be switched
    It's not that we just look alike. Everyone thinks we're interchangeable.
  2. platform
    a document stating the principles of a political party
    We can help each other with our platforms!
  3. technically
    according to the exact meaning; according to the facts
    Though, technically, I didn't say immediately after church.
  4. self-confidence
    belief in your own abilities or judgment
    I didn't say you had no self-confidence. I said low self-confidence.
  5. disingenuous
    not straightforward or candid
    It feels disingenuous not to be honest about your intentions.
  6. civil
    not rude
    I don't like it...but we won't force either of you to drop out.
    As long as you keep it civil.
  7. compassionate
    showing or having sympathy for another's suffering
    I thought leaders were supposed to be compassionate.
  8. rig
    arrange the outcome of by means of deceit
    The game was rigged.
  9. construct
    an abstract or general idea inferred from specific instances
    Duh! Gender is a construct.
  10. psychic
    a person sensitive to things beyond natural perception
    But don't you guys share the same thoughts? You know, like twin psychic powers?
  11. exemplary
    worthy of imitation
    Also, exemplary job on your exam yesterday.
  12. vandalize
    intentionally destroy or deface someone else's property
    Francine vandalized one of my posters at school.
  13. indefinitely
    to an unknown extent
    You're grounded indefinitely.
  14. frank
    characterized by directness in manner or speech
    And, quite frankly, it isn't your decision.
  15. accompany
    perform a supporting musical part
    Francine's platform was all about more interaction between clubs at school. Like asking the chorus to sing while the orchestra accompanied them.
  16. trait
    a distinguishing feature of your personal nature
    What are traits of a good leader?
  17. compose
    write music
    Would you ask Picasso to stop drawing? Or Mozart to stop composing?
  18. operation
    a calculation by mathematical methods
    You've almost got it! But remember the order of operations.
  19. pulpit
    a platform raised to give prominence to the person on it
    She sounded like she should be in a church pulpit...Not a school assembly.
  20. decline
    refuse to accept
    My sister asked me to help organize Showcase Days...
    But I declined.
